I created a composite chart composed with a column chart and a scatter chart (dotted line).

At first glance, it seems to work ok (see "date offset.jpg"). The problem I have is that there's an offset between the dotted line and the column chart.

For example, if you look at the data that serves to generated the chart (see "chart data.jpg"), the dotted line value at the date "2014-03-02" should be "750" but it is "1350".

The problem I think I have is that the width between two points is not the same as the width of a column, so the offset is created from that. What properties can I adjust to solve this?

As you will see in my code, I had to create an X2 axis to be able to display the dotted line and from what I read, I cannot use the same "string" datatatype on the other axis so I created a "SemaineCount" (WeekCount in English) to use as the X value. Maybe the source of the problem resides there...
